So, evaluate first before …If you do it yourself, an oil change is just the price of the oil, which is about $5 to $10 per quart for synthetic. The average car takes 5 to 8 quarts, making the total for a DIY oil change $25 to $80. If you get a shop to do it, you’ll have to pay for the labor, but the oil will probably cost them a little less.

After long runtimes. Portable generators handle small power loads thereby needing an oil change after 50 -100 hours. If your generator runs for long hours, you should change the oil after 50 hours. Otherwise, 100 hour-intervals are sufficient. Always change the filter whenever changing the oil. Say you get your oil changed every 3,000 miles, and each change costs $40. If you’re replacing your oil every 3,000 miles, putting 30,000 on your car over two years will cost you $400 in oil changes. Upping the mileage between oil changes will reduce your cost to $160, a savings of $240. If you’re l...Jan 12, 2021 · How often you change your motorcycle oil will depend on the type of oil it uses, the number of miles and frequency it’s driven. Your user manual will provide the recommended service intervals, but as a general rule: Mineral oil should be replaced every 2,000 to 3,000 miles, or at least once a year.
